Figure S1. Hg concentrations in rainfall collected at the GTC site in Cleveland, OH (a) and the LCM site in Medina, OH (b) from July 2009 – December 2010. 1

Figure S2. Top panel, GPS coordinates for cities in Ohio, middle panel, north to south annual 2009 and 2010 precipitation gradients for these cities, bottom panel, west to east gradient annual 2009 and 2010 precipitation gradients for these cities. 2
